Output 62eeecfd1136898aea7612a87e82997725867160fc029d57f81316b7d0f3a6ee:1

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84bc62f29aafb8906149c3e3bb98fa3b1975871a OP_EQUAL
address
3DnroBxw6VjsEvzQ3RpchCgMUbED9fVApW
transaction
62eeecfd1136898aea7612a87e82997725867160fc029d57f81316b7d0f3a6ee
spent
true